This time of year is a little tricky. The temps for this week are highs from 70 to high 60's during the day and then in the 50's to high 40's at night. November always seems to be when we have our big weather change. We have no fall here. One day it is in the high seventies and the next day it drops 10 degrees and it is the beginning of winter, not to say it won't go back up to the eighties at the beginning of December or snow (lightly and then melt immediately). The secret is layers, so definitely bring the Barefoot Dreams poncho. Don't bring heavy sweaters, especially if you are a person who is mostly warm. Your blood will be thicker than ours since you are from a cold climate - that's why the winter visitors wear shorts in the winter.
